5. Definition
cannabis (hemp)“ means-
(a) charas, is the resin, in crude or purified, obtained from
cannabis plant including hashish oil or liquid hashish;
(b) Ganja - the flowering & fruiting tops of the cannabis plant
(c) any mixture, with or without any neutral material, of any
of the forms of cannabis or any drink prepared from them.
6. "coca derivative" means-
(a) crude cocaine, that is, any extract of coca leaf which can be
used, directly or indirectly, for the manufacture of cocaine;
(b) ecgonine and all the derivatives of ecgonine from which it can
be recovered;
(c) cocaine, that is, methyl ester of benzoyl-ecgonine and its
salts; and
(d) all preparations containing more than 0.1 per cent. of cocaine
Manufactured drug means -
In relation to narcotic drugs or psychotropic substances, includes-
(1) All processes other than production by which such drugs or substances may be obtained;
(2) Refining or transformation of such drugs or substances;
7. “Manufactured drug" means-
(a) All coca derivatives, medicinal
cannabis, opium derivative and
poppy straw concentrate;
(b) Any other narcotic substance or
preparation declared by the Central
Government, if any, under any
International Convention, by
notification in the Official Gazette,
declare to be a manufactured drug;
Medicinal cannabis“ that is, medicinal hemp, means
Any extract or tincture of cannabis (hemp); narcotic drug" means coca leaf, cannabis (hemp), opium,
poppy straw and includes all manufactured drugs;
8. Opium" means-
(a) The plant of the species Papaver somniferum L.
(b) The coagulated juice of the opium poppy; and
(c) Any mixture, with or without any neutral
material, of the coagulated juice of the opium
poppy, but does not include any preparation
containing not more than 0.2 per cent. of
morphine;
Opium derivative“ means
Medicinal opium – b. Prepared opium
I. Phenanthrene alkaloids such as morphine, codeine, and their salts, Diacetyl morphine (heroin) and its
salts .
II. All preparation containing more than 0.2% of morphine or any amount of diacetyl morphine
9. Poppy straw“ means
All parts (except the seeds) of the opium poppy
after harvesting whether in their original form or
cut, crushed or powdered form.
“Psychotropic substance" means
Any substance, natural or synthetic, or any salt or
preparation of such substance included in the list of
psychotropic substances specified in the Schedules
10. “Illicit traffic", in relation to narcotic drugs and psychotropic substances, means-
(i) Cultivating any coca plant or gathering any portion of coca plant; opium poppy or any cannabis plant;
(ii) Engaging in the Production, Manufacture, Possession, sale, transportation, warehousing
concealment, use or consumption, import inter- State, export inter-State, import into India,
export from India or transhipment, of narcotic drugs or psychotropic substances

17. Power of state government to permit, control and regulate:
1. Permission and regulation of certain operation by state government:
• Possession, transport, interstate import, export, warehousing, sale, purchase, consumption
and use of poppy straw.
• Cultivation of any cannabis plant production, manufacturing, possession, transport, import,
export, sale, purchase, and use of cannabis.
• Possession, transport, purchase, sale, interstate import, export, use and consumption of
manufactured drugs other than prepared opium.
• The manufacture and possession of prepared opium from opium lawfully processed by an addict
registered with state government on medical advice are his personal conception.
18. 1. The land for poppy cultivation shall be free from litigation.
2. The licence for cultivation of opium poppy shall specify the area and designate the plots on which cultivation
take place.
3. The licensee shall not transfer his licence and cultivate poppy for production of opium or poppy show over the
area of land and plots specified in the license.
4. The licensee shall bring the opium and deliver at place fixed for weighment all opium collected by him from the
crop and he should accept that the prize of opium he fixed by central government.
5. The delivery and weighment of opium shall be under the supervision of district opium officer or any other
officer authorized by narcotic commissioner.
6. Final payment for opium delivered by him shall be made of appropriate time.
7. He should obey the provisions and order issued by component authorities.
8. The license shall be cancelled making him disqualified for grant of license. If he breaks any law for any reason
of the condition's, he may punishable.
9. District opium officer designate one of cultivator of opium poppy as lambardor in each village where opium
poppy is cultivated.
10. Lambardor shall perform his given function and on such terms and conditions as given by narcotic commissioner.
